  • Updated UD3R bios to F12 now BSOD

    So updated BIOS hoping for a fix for the S3 reboot loop bug. Now immed after Windows shows loading screen I get a BSOD. Tried resetting to Opt Defaults & resetting SATA mode to AHCI, no go. Anyone else getting this?

    Specs are
    2x2GB DDR2
    Win 7 64bit
    AHCI install
    e8400

    Re: Updated UD3R bios to F12 now BSOD

    Have you made any changes in M.I.T before to gain stability, and did you re-applied them after flashing if you have.
    Try clearing CMOS as explained in the second part of this post, then load optimized defaults, save & reboot, enter BIOS again and reapply any changes nesessary for AHCI/disk boot orde etc.
    Try increasing MCH Core 1.2v up to 1.24v if needed, if it doesn't help try 1.05-0.95v.

    Additional information is needed for further advise, please follow steps 1-4 in this post.
